HS: Spring state, region rankings, May 21
In addition to lifting Nebraska Class AA state title trophies, Kearney boys and Millard North girls had one other thing in common this season.
Both teams started the season ranked ranked No. 5 in the state, and both inched their way to the top -- finishing with state No. 1 rankings this week.
Nebraska, Arkansas and Wyoming were the states that closed out seasons this past week. In addition, the North Carolina independent schools crowned its spring girls soccer state champions, and to little surprise national power Charlotte Latin (Charlotte, N.C.) claimed a fourth straight state title. Utah finished its boys spring season for the two smaller classifications this past week.
In Arkansas, Russellville boys and Siloam Springs girls finished No. 1 with state titles. In Wyoming, Worland boys and Cheyenne Central girls started the week at No. 2 but finished as No. 1 with state titles.
Nationally, there was very little change among the elite teams. Broomfield (Colo.) and Grandview (Aurora, Colo.) have gone most of the season in the No. 1 and 2 positions in Colorado and the undefeated powers have worked their way into a state final showdown that highlights this week's national schedule.
